A simplified model for nuclear steam generator

Description

In this work a simplified model is developed for the simulation of the thermal-hydraulic parameters of U-tube steam generators (UTSG) used in nuclear power plants. These are arrived at by solving steady, one-dimensional area averaged conservation equations of mass momentum and energy using finite difference method. The results obtained for the steam generators used in Indian nuclear power station compared well with those obtained by three dimensional HELIOS computer code. Further, the results obtained for a typical Westinghouse steam generator compare favourably with the experimental results. (author). 8 refs., 8 figs., 5 tabs
